... SATA power connectors has a total of 15 pins of which 9 are power pins (3 x 3.3V, 3 x 5V, 3 x 12V). Each pin can carry 1.5Amps for a total of 13.5Amps. BUT as there is as yet no use for the 3.3V pins the effective power available to drives is only 9Amps.
9 amps is 108watts im running 2 x 290 gpus from one sata atm with no problems
@woodaxe, You are wrong. Examine your own figures... Of the 9 Amperes, half is at 5V and half at 12V. 4.5*5 + 4.5*12 = 76.5W which is NOT 108W.

I stuck on point with loading drivers in device manager on win 7 64. I always get ! with code 43 error, seem unbraekable, to get properly working driver with mod bios :{
This is because of driver signing. If you change your BIOS, you card will show this error code. You will have a display, but you won't be able to test mining and such. There's a fix for that though, someone else should be able to point your to it. I haven't applied it myself yet.
Can anyone write what steps do after flashing bios and rebooting? How to override driver properly in win7, win8.1, win10? @RavinderDhillon, @dephcon, @Marvell9, @zorg33?
Step 1 : Download the modded AMD Driver file here Step 2 : Download the NGOHQ driver signing tool here Step 3 : Do the following to enable Windows Test Mode- WindowsKey + X -> Command prompt (Admin mode) bcdedit.exe -set loadoptions DDISABLE_INTEGRITY_CHECKS bcdedit.exe -set TESTSIGNING ON Step 4 : Use the NGOHQ tool and select test mode, then restart pc. Now run the tool again and sign the modded driver file that you downloaded above (this has to be done on the pc that you will be using it on). Step 5 : Hold Shift and click on power to restart in safe mode (look it up). In safe mode, replace the original in system32/drivers with the modded file Step 6 : Reboot into windows normally and now drivers will recognize any modded bios
